All over Sydney, giant masses of bright purple flowers can be seen. These belong to Jacaranda mimosifolia, a tree planted throughout the city. While they are beloved by many residents for their gorgeous spring colors, I was surprised to discover that these trees aren’t actually native to Australia but originate from South America. While they are not classified as invasive in New South Wales, they are considered invasive in other parts of Australia. Are there any non-native plants that grow commonly in your area?
